# CVE-2006-3016

Publication date 14 June 2006

## Description

Unspecified vulnerability in session.c in PHP before 5.1.3 has unknown
impact and attack vectors, related to "certain characters in session
names," including special characters that are frequently associated with
CRLF injection, SQL injection, cross-site scripting (XSS), and HTTP
response splitting vulnerabilities. NOTE: while the nature of the
vulnerability is unspecified, it is likely that this is related to a
violation of an expectation by PHP applications that the session name is
alphanumeric, as implied in the PHP manual for session\_name().
